If a stock is paying an indicated dividend of $1 per share and is trading with a price of $40, its dividend yield is 2.5% ($1 ÷ $40 = 0.025, or 2.5%). If a stock’s price rises faster than its ....

High dividend stocks are stocks with a dividend yield well in excess of the market average dividend yield of ~1.7%. Banyak yang mungkin belum mengetahui daftar saham IDX High Dividend 20 2023 yang merupakan salah satu indeks menarik untuk diikuti.Jun 25, 2020 · A high-dividend yield is one that falls above the average yield of stocks sold on that market. For example, the average dividend yield of the S&P 500, which is known as the market’s main bellwether, is 2.31% and usually hovers around 2%. So, a stock with a dividend yield of say 5.3% would be considered a higher dividend stock.
